######################################################################
-# Version $Id: bat.pro.in 7051 2008-05-29 01:19:31Z bartleyd2 $
#
-# !!!!!!! IMPORTANT !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
+# !!!!!!! IMPORTANT !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
#
-# Edit only bat.pro.in -- bat.pro is built by the ./configure program
+# Edit only bat.pro.mingw32.in -- bat.pro.mingw32 is built by the ./configure program
#
-# !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
+# !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
#
-CONFIG += qt debug cross-win32
+CONFIG += qt cross-win32
+# CONFIG += debug
bins.path = ./
bins.files = ./bat
cross-win32 {
# LIBS += ../win32/dll/bacula.a
- LIBS += -mwindows -L../win32/release -lbacula
+ LIBS += -mwindows -L../win32/release32 -lbacula
}
!cross-win32 {
- LIBS += -L../lib -lbac @OPENSSL_LIBS@
+ LIBS += -L../lib -lbac -L../findlib -lbacfind @OPENSSL_LIBS@
}
qwt {
}
RESOURCES = main.qrc
-MOC_DIR = moc
-OBJECTS_DIR = obj
-UI_DIR = ui
+MOC_DIR = moc32
+OBJECTS_DIR = obj32
+UI_DIR = ui32
# Main window
FORMS += main.ui
FORMS += prefs.ui
FORMS += label/label.ui
FORMS += relabel/relabel.ui
-FORMS += mount/mount.ui
-FORMS += console/console.ui
+FORMS += mount/mount.ui
+FORMS += console/console.ui
FORMS += restore/restore.ui restore/prerestore.ui restore/brestore.ui
-FORMS += restore/restoretree.ui
-FORMS += run/run.ui run/runcmd.ui run/estimate.ui run/prune.ui
-FORMS += select/select.ui
+FORMS += restore/runrestore.ui restore/restoretree.ui
+FORMS += run/run.ui run/runcmd.ui run/estimate.ui run/prune.ui
+FORMS += select/select.ui select/textinput.ui
FORMS += medialist/medialist.ui mediaedit/mediaedit.ui joblist/joblist.ui
-FORMS += clients/clients.ui storage/storage.ui fileset/fileset.ui
-FORMS += joblog/joblog.ui jobs/jobs.ui
-FORMS += help/help.ui
-FORMS += status/dirstat.ui
-FORMS += status/clientstat.ui
-FORMS += status/storstat.ui
-qwt {
- FORMS += jobgraphs/jobplotcontrols.ui
-}
+FORMS += medialist/mediaview.ui
+FORMS += clients/clients.ui storage/storage.ui fileset/fileset.ui
+FORMS += joblog/joblog.ui jobs/jobs.ui job/job.ui
+FORMS += help/help.ui mediainfo/mediainfo.ui
+FORMS += status/dirstat.ui storage/content.ui
+FORMS += status/clientstat.ui
+FORMS += status/storstat.ui
+qwt {
+ FORMS += jobgraphs/jobplotcontrols.ui
+}
# Main directory
HEADERS += mainwin.h bat.h bat_conf.h qstd.h pages.h
# Console
HEADERS += console/console.h
-SOURCES += console/authenticate.cpp console/console.cpp
+SOURCES += console/console.cpp
# Restore
HEADERS += restore/restore.h
SOURCES += run/run.cpp run/runcmd.cpp run/estimate.cpp run/prune.cpp
# Select dialog
-HEADERS += select/select.h
-SOURCES += select/select.cpp
+HEADERS += select/select.h select/textinput.h
+SOURCES += select/select.cpp select/textinput.cpp
## MediaList
HEADERS += medialist/medialist.h
SOURCES += medialist/medialist.cpp
+# MediaView
+HEADERS += medialist/mediaview.h
+SOURCES += medialist/mediaview.cpp
+
## MediaEdit
HEADERS += mediaedit/mediaedit.h
SOURCES += mediaedit/mediaedit.cpp
HEADERS += storage/storage.h
SOURCES += storage/storage.cpp
+## Storage content
+HEADERS += storage/content.h
+SOURCES += storage/content.cpp
+
## Fileset
HEADERS += fileset/fileset.h
SOURCES += fileset/fileset.cpp
HEADERS += joblog/joblog.h
SOURCES += joblog/joblog.cpp
+## Job
+HEADERS += job/job.h
+SOURCES += job/job.cpp
+
## Jobs
HEADERS += jobs/jobs.h
SOURCES += jobs/jobs.cpp
HEADERS += help/help.h
SOURCES += help/help.cpp
+# Media info dialog
+HEADERS += mediainfo/mediainfo.h
+SOURCES += mediainfo/mediainfo.cpp
+
## Status Dir
HEADERS += status/dirstat.h
SOURCES += status/dirstat.cpp